Mediterranean Spaghetti Delight
This Mediterranean Spaghetti Delight is a vibrant and wholesome dish that brings together the rich culinary traditions of Morocco with the comforting familiarity of pasta. Adapted from Simon Rimmer's 'Accidental Vegetarian,' this dish is designed to be low in fat while packed with flavor and nutrients. Featuring whole wheat spaghetti for added fiber and a blend of warming spices like cinnamon and cumin, it provides a deliciously healthy meal that is also vegan, low-fat, and low-glycemic. The combination of chickpeas, fresh herbs, and tomatoes ensures that every bite is not only satisfying but also beneficial for those with insulin sensitivity or anyone looking to eat lighter without compromising on taste. Ingredients

Whole wheat spaghetti 11 ounces (uncooked)
Red onion 1 (chopped finely)
Garlic cloves 3 (crushed)
Mushrooms 1 cup (sliced)
Chopped tomatoes 28 ounces (from a can)
Cinnamon 2 teaspoons (ground)
Ground cumin 2 teaspoons (ground)
Turmeric 1 teaspoon (ground)
Salt 1 pinch (to taste)
Black pepper 1 pinch (to taste)
Chickpeas 10 ounces (from a can, drained and rinsed)
Fresh parsley 3/4 cup (roughly chopped)
Fresh cilantro 3/4 cup (roughly chopped)

Instructions

1
Bring a large pot of water to a rolling boil and add the whole wheat spaghetti. Cook it according to the package instructions, usually about 10 minutes, or until al dente. Drain and set aside.
2
Meanwhile, in a non-stick skillet, spray a light coating of low-fat cooking spray. Add the chopped red onion, crushed garlic, and sliced mushrooms to the pan. Sauté over medium heat for about 5 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the vegetables start to soften. If they begin to stick, add a splash of water to keep them from browning.
3
Once the vegetables are tender, add the canned chopped tomatoes along with the cinnamon, ground cumin, turmeric, salt, and black pepper. Stir well and allow the mixture to simmer gently for about 8 minutes, stirring frequently to prevent sticking.
4
Add the drained and rinsed chickpeas to the pan, stirring to combine. Cook for an additional 3 minutes until the chickpeas are heated through.
5
Fold in the freshly chopped parsley and cilantro, mixing gently until the herbs begin to wilt.
6
Finally, add the drained spaghetti to the skillet and toss everything together ensuring the pasta is evenly coated with the flavorful sauce.
7
Serve hot, garnished with additional herbs if desired.
